Common Dryer Issues

GE dryer drum belt slipped off pulley
GE dryers use a long thin drum belt that wraps around the motor pulley and idler. After years of use the belt stretches and snaps or slips off. Replacing the GE drum belt and inspecting the idler pulley restores normal drum rotation.
GE dryer not heating despite running
On GE electric dryers, the heating coil and a one-shot thermal fuse on the blower housing are the typical no-heat suspects. A blocked exhaust often trips the fuse. Replacing the element and fuse alongside clearing the vent restores heat.
GE dryer takes too long to dry
Lint accumulation inside the GE cabinet, blower wheel, and exhaust path is the leading cause of long dry times. A cracked blower wheel further reduces airflow. Deep-cleaning the lint path and replacing the blower wheel as needed shortens cycles.
GE dryer rear drum rollers worn
The rear drum support rollers on GE dryers wear flat over time, causing rumbling and uneven drum rotation. The shaft can also wear if rollers are not replaced. Installing new rollers and verifying the shaft restores smooth operation.
GE dryer overheating and shutting off
Restricted venting and a defective cycling thermostat cause GE dryers to overheat and trip the high-limit safety. Lint near the heater housing retains heat. Cleaning the cabinet and replacing the thermostat resolves repeated shutdowns.
GE dryer start button not responding
A failed start switch or worn door switch on GE dryers prevents the start circuit from completing. The thermal fuse can also be open. Testing each component and replacing the failed part restores normal start behavior.
GE gas dryer igniter not glowing
On GE gas dryers, the silicon-carbide igniter is fragile and can fracture from vibration or age. The gas valve coils can also fail to open. Replacing the igniter and coils restores reliable gas ignition.
GE dryer control board failure
Power surges in Jacksonville thunderstorms commonly damage GE dryer main control boards, causing blank displays or erratic operation. Replacing the main control board and adding a surge protector restores normal function and prevents repeat damage.

General Electric Appliances — marketed as GE Appliances — is one of the most iconic names in American home appliance history, with roots that trace back to Thomas Edison's original General Electric Company founded in 1892. GE introduced household appliances including electric ranges in the early 1900s and refrigerators in 1927, becoming a fixture in American homes for over a century. The appliance division was acquired by the Chinese manufacturer Haier in 2016 and now operates as an independent subsidiary under the GE Appliances brand, continuing to manufacture products at its Appliance Park facility in Louisville, Kentucky. GE Appliances produces an extensive range of residential products including Profile and Cafe premium lines, alongside standard GE-branded refrigerators, dishwashers, ranges, wall ovens, washers, and dryers. FAQ

How much does GE dryer repair cost in Jacksonville?

GE dryer repairs in Jacksonville typically run $120 to $420. Belts, fuses, and rollers are affordable, while control boards and gas valve coils cost more. A written estimate is provided after diagnosis.

Should I repair or replace an older GE dryer?

GE dryers are durable workhorses worth repairing through 12 to 14 years of use. If multiple major parts fail simultaneously on a very old unit, replacement may be more practical. We share an honest assessment.

How long does a GE dryer repair take?

Most GE dryer repairs such as belts, fuses, rollers, and switches are completed in a single visit. Control boards and gas valve coils may need 1 to 2 business days for parts.
